Unfortunately, people of all ages can experience constipation at some point in their lives, whether they are babies, young children, adults or seniors. As you already probably know, constipation occurs when your bowel movements are tough or happen less often than normal. There are a lot of factors that can cause constipation, including digestive problems, your diet and lifestyle choices or it is simply a sign that you are suffering from other different diseases. 

As in the case with other conditions, symptoms vary from person to person and can range from mild to severe. It’s important to remember that occasional constipation is very common, especially in menstruating women, but it can also be a chronic condition in some cases and it can affect your quality of life. So, try to talk to your doctor if you think you suffer from chronic constipation. According to statistics, constipation affects more than twenty percent of people in the United States.
